摘要:在日常開發中,有時候需要將漢字轉換成拼音,MySQL也提供了相應的函數來實現這一功能,本文將介紹如何使用MySQL實現漢字轉拼音首字母大寫的功能。
1. 準備工作
在使用MySQL實現漢字轉拼音首字母大寫之前,我們需要先進行一些準備工作。
首先,確保MySQL的版本是5.7以上,因為5.7版本之前的MySQL并不支持中文字符集。
yinyin插件是一個MySQL的用戶自定義函數庫,可以將漢字轉換成拼音。安裝方法如下:
yin插件的源碼
② 解壓源碼文件,并進入解壓后的目錄
③ 執行以下命令進行編譯安裝:
akeakestall
ysqlfunctionsyin插件。
2. 實現漢字轉拼音首字母大寫
yin插件之后,我們就可以開始實現漢字轉拼音首字母大寫的功能了。
yin插件:
ysqlyinysqlfunctions.so';
yin函數將漢字轉換成拼音,如下所示:
ysqlyin('中國');
g guó
接下來,我們需要將拼音的首字母大寫,可以使用MySQL中的ucwords函數實現,如下所示:
ysqlyin('中國'));
g Guó
至此,我們已經成功實現了漢字轉拼音首字母大寫的功能。
3. 總結
yinyin插件的安裝。使用ucwords函數可以將拼音的首字母大寫。希望本文能夠對大家有所幫助。